Profil

You can change your profile via the primedocs tab. If several profiles are available to you, you can change your selection at any time by clicking on the Profile button. As in the client, a list of all the profiles available to you will open. Select your desired profile here.

If this button is grayed out, this simply means that the document you have opened does not use any profile information from primedocs.

Language

The button for the document language is located directly below the profile selection button. If you change the document language, the spell check language of the entire document is changed to the language you have selected and any text modules that have been translated into this language are displayed in the selected language.


Content group

Snippets

Snippets are a very powerful feature - so let's take a moment to get to know them a little better:

Snippets are blocks of content (text, tables, images, etc.) that you can save and reuse in any other document without having to copy and paste from other documents. They are very easy to create and edit. And if you use them skillfully, they can save you an enormous amount of time!

image-20230310-102511-20240320-153042.png

There are basically two types of snippets: "Shared" and "Custom" snippets.

Private snippets

Every user can create their own snippets. They belong to you and only you. No one else can see them (not even administrators).

Shared snippets

Shared snippets are created centrally and are accessible to everyone or to specific user groups in your company. If you need to be able to create shared snippets, contact your internal support.

Create snippets

So how do you create a snippets? It's quite simple. Select a text and drag it to the right-hand area, e.g. under "My snippets". Then save it there. A window opens in which the name of the snippets and the language recognized by Word are specified. Correct the document language if necessary, click OK and the snippets is saved.

Insert snippets

To use this snippets later in another (or of course the same) document, click with the mouse at the point where the snippet is to be inserted. Then double-click on the desired snippets in the snippets panel; the snippets will be inserted.

Alternatively, you can also drag the snippets from the snippets panel to the desired position using drag'n'drop.

Snippets in different languages

There are some advanced functions, such as the ability to overlay different language versions of the same snippet by selecting a text in English, for example, and placing it over an existing snippet. primedocs then saves each language version in the same snippet.

To insert a multilingual snippet into a document, proceed in the same way as for a monolingual snippet. primedocs then automatically inserts the snippet in the correct language - provided the document language in the primedocs menu bar is selected correctly.

Alternatively, you can right-click on the snippets and select which language version you want to insert. In this case, the snippets will be inserted at the point where the cursor is located in the document.

Format group

Fill color / Line color / Text color

There are three buttons for color management right next to the "Snippets" button. You can apply fill, line or text colors to your document here. These are stored according to the design (CI/CD) of your organizational unit - so you don't have to worry about which colors are allowed and which are not.
